HABITAT_WEST LOS ANGELES_ LIVING WITH EXTREAMS
The main idea is to create a Habitat in West Los Angeles along the coast from Venice Beach to Santa Monica. The concept is intended to protect against the catastrophes that are to become increasingly strong over the next few years, such as flood, heat, storm and earthquake. Urban elements should be protected against the extreme conditions. New solutions are to be developed from the coming extremes, so that the coming flood water will be used to cool down against the heat and a canal will be created as used in Venice as a waterway. High buildings are to divert the extreme winds and lead as breeze over the canal to create a natural ventilation of the quarter. This urban structure is to take precedence as an example to show that a forward-looking planning can create new solutions against the coming climate change.
